Understanding Windshield Camera Calibration
What is Windshield Camera Calibration?
Windshield camera calibration is the process of adjusting the cameras in your car to ensure they work correctly with the vehicle’s advanced driver assistance systems (ADAS). These systems include features like lane-keeping assist, adaptive cruise control, and automatic emergency braking. When your windshield gets replaced or if the camera gets misaligned, a recalibration is necessary. This ensures the cameras are accurately tracking the road and surrounding environment.
Why Modern Vehicles Need It
Modern vehicles have become smart machines packed with technology that enhances safety and convenience. Many of these safety features depend on precise camera placement and alignment. A slight misalignment can cause these systems to malfunction or give false readings. For instance, if your lane-keeping assist system doesn’t read the lanes correctly, it can lead to unsafe driving conditions. Calibration ensures all the cameras and sensors are aligned correctly, providing accurate data to help keep you safe on the road.
How Windshield Camera Calibration Works
Steps Involved in Calibration
The calibration process involves several steps to ensure accuracy. First, the technician will set up the vehicle in a controlled environment, often using a special calibration frame or target. The vehicle’s system is then connected to a diagnostic tool that guides the technician through the calibration process. This tool sends signals to the camera and sensors, checking their alignment and making necessary adjustments. The process can take anywhere from 30 minutes to a few hours, depending on the vehicle and the complexity of its systems.
Tools Used for Accurate Calibration
Accurate calibration requires specialized tools and equipment. Technicians use calibration frames, patterns, and targets to ensure the cameras and sensors are properly aligned. They also use diagnostic tools that communicate with the vehicle’s ADAS. These tools provide data and feedback, allowing the technician to make precise adjustments. Additionally, technicians often use levelers, laser guides, and other measuring tools to ensure everything is aligned perfectly. The combination of these tools ensures that the calibration is done accurately, keeping your vehicle’s safety features functioning as they should.
The Safety Benefits of Proper Calibration
Enhanced Driver Assistance Systems
Properly calibrated windshield cameras are essential for the optimal performance of your vehicle’s advanced driver assistance systems (ADAS). These systems rely on accurate data to function correctly. For example, lane-keeping assist helps you stay within your lane, and adaptive cruise control adjusts your speed to maintain a safe distance from the car ahead. When the cameras are accurately calibrated, these features work seamlessly, making your drive safer and more comfortable.
Preventing Accidents and Errors
One of the biggest benefits of proper calibration is accident prevention. Misaligned cameras can give incorrect data, leading to false alerts or even a failure to alert you in critical situations. For instance, a miscalibrated camera might not detect a pedestrian correctly, putting everyone at risk. Regular calibration ensures that all the safety features in your car can detect and respond to real-world driving conditions accurately. This helps prevent accidents and improves overall road safety.
When to Get Your Windshield Camera Calibrated
Signs It’s Time for Calibration
Knowing when to calibrate your windshield cameras is crucial. Signs that it’s time for calibration include dashboard warnings from the ADAS, faulty lane assistance, or if the camera has been removed or replaced. Additionally, after any windshield replacement or major collision, you should get your cameras checked. Trusting these alerts and staying aware helps maintain the accuracy of your vehicle’s safety features.
